“The Mystery Trail to Stagecoach Town!”

From the sun-baked badlands of the American West, DC's Hopalong Cassidy #107 arrives with a photo cover showcasing William Boyd in full black cowboy regalia — twin revolvers drawn, silver star gleaming, his white horse standing tall beside him — every inch the screen hero the header proudly calls "America's Favorite Cowboy." A bold circular emblem touts the lead story, "Riddle of the Masked Lawman!," complete with a dramatic domino mask graphic that hints at mystery riding alongside the action. Inside, Ed Herron's script and Gene Colan's art (inked by Ray Burnley) carry Hoppy through "The Mystery Trail to Stagecoach Town!" — all new stories for a dime, stamped with the Comics Code seal of 1955.
